I keep getting the following tab page which opens about every 3rd time of so I go to a new site or even if it's one of my favorites.
Reported Internet Insecurity: Navigation Blocked
(Little Red Shield with an X) Insecure Internet activity.
Threat of virus attack
Due to insecure Internet browsing your PC can easily get infected with viruses, worms and trojans without your knowledge, and that can lead to system slowdown, freezes and crashes.
Also insecure Internet activity can result in revealing your personal information.
To get full advanced real-time protection for PC and Internet activity, register KvmSecure.
We recommend you to protect your PC now and continue safe Internet browsing.
Click here to get full advanced real-time protection and continue browsing.
Continue to this website unprotected (not recommended).
Nothing happens when I select continue to website, but when I go back it takes me to my previous page?
Is this generated by Microsoft? It seems like they are trying to sell you this internet security s/w package.
How do I get rid of this pop up???

Here are the links for SAS & MBAM:
SUPERAntiSpyware
Malwarebytes' Anti-Malware
Make sure both programs are fully updated. Then reboot into safe mode, By pressing "f8" on the keyboard until you get to the Black config Screen for Safe Mode. Run both Scans in that mode (But don't run them both at the same time), Remove the threats found and reboot in normal mode.
